Intown Pediatrics & Adolescent Medicine: A Legacy of Care



This September, Intown Pediatrics & Adolescent Medicine proudly celebrates its 19th anniversary, marking nearly two decades of dedicated pediatric healthcare for families throughout Atlanta. Founded in 2006 by the visionary Dr. Deneta H. Sells, the practice has transformed from a single location in a charming Grant Park bungalow to three vibrant facilities strategically situated in Glenwood Park, Brookhaven, and Decatur, serving thousands of families.

Remarkable Growth and Expansion



Since its inception, Intown Pediatrics has witnessed remarkable growth, mirroring the exceptional quality of service it provides. Originally a solo practice, the need for more comprehensive facilities arose quickly, leading to a move to a larger location in Glenwood Park just three years after opening. As patient demand continued to rise, the practice expanded again, adding locations in Brookhaven in May 2017 and Decatur in April 2022. This growth underscores a commitment to meeting the healthcare needs of families throughout the Atlanta metropolitan area.

Today, Intown Pediatrics employs a skilled team of five board-certified pediatricians and nurse practitioners, who deliver comprehensive care across various age groups, from newborns to young adults. This encompasses services like well-child visits, immunizations, chronic condition management (including asthma and ADHD), behavioral health support, and specialized adolescent healthcare.
